How much do homes sell for in Astoria, SD?
The average home price is currently $328,935.
In Astoria, SD, how many homes are available?
There are currently 1 active home listings available in Astoria.
What’s the average rental cost in Astoria, SD?
The average rental price in Astoria is $1,114.
What is the most expensive home in Astoria?
The most expensive home sold in Astoria had a price of $944,400.
What is currently the cheapest priced home in Astoria, SD?
The cheapest home for sale in Astoria is priced at $90,499.

Home Value Estimator For Astoria, SD
There are currently 135 real estate properties
in Astoria, SD,
with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price
of $260,197.00. What is an AVM? It is
a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home,
property or land in Astoria, SD, based on current market
trends, comparable real
est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other
vari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ers
and
s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process. For
example,
the average home price in Astoria, SD,
is $328,935.00, with the most expensive house
in Astoria, SD, topping out
at $944,400.00 and the cheapest home
in Astoria, SD,
clocking in at $90,499.00. In other words, there’s
something for every potential homebuyer
or savvy investor in Astoria, SD!
Rent Prices
In Astoria, SD
With the expiration of certain local, state and federal housing-related restrictions
and
mandated programs, the rental market in Astoria, SD, is on
a rollercoaster ride. The
average rent price in Astoria, SD,
is $1,114.00. Indeed, when looking to rent in
Astoria, SD, you can expect to pay as little
as $820.00 or as much
as $2,070.00,
with the average rent median estimated to
be $1,040.00. The good news is that finding
an affordable and desirable property to rent in Astoria, SD
-- whether it’s apartments,
townhomes, condominiums or single-family homes -- is made easier with knowledge of
the
local market and, of course, a little patience.
